Cleveland Clinic Abu Dhabi earns JCI’s ‘Gold Seal of Approval’

 

Abu Dhabi / WAM

A new benchmark for patient care has been set by Cleveland Clinic Abu Dhabi, part of Mubadala’s network of world-class healthcare providers, as the medical campus announced it has earned the prestigious Joint Commission International’s (JCI) Gold Seal of Approval for hospital accreditation after only 18 months of operations. The award is a global symbol of quality that reflects an organization’s commitment to providing safe and effective patient care.
With the UAE healthcare sector set to continue its rapid growth in the coming decades and some experts estimating that the total UAE healthcare market will reach US$19.5 billion by 2020 due to the rise of non-communicable diseases and growing healthcare expenditure, patient safety is a major priority for healthcare institutions in the country. Accreditation by recognized international institutions such as JCI is crucial to drive compliance and improve quality and cost-effectiveness across the healthcare system by developing evidence-based standardized methods and measures to identify errors and reduce adverse events that occur in hospitals.
Accreditation has become a priority for healthcare hubs around the world, with many countries moving toward making accreditation mandatory. By 2020, only accredited healthcare providers will be allowed to operate in the UAE, aligned with the country’s vision to develop a world-class healthcare sector following international standards. The UAE currently leads the world with the highest number of accredited organizations, and progressing toward international accreditation for all healthcare facilities.
In line with Cleveland Clinic Abu Dhabi’s ‘Patient First’ philosophy, the Quality & Patient Safety Institute leads the hospital’s quality efforts, promoting effective, efficient and safe healthcare, and setting safety and quality benchmarks through strategic systems improvement, clinical culture and innovation.
Expert surveyors from JCI carried out a rigorous evaluation of Cleveland Clinic Abu Dhabi’s hospital standards across emergency management, environment of care, infection prevention and control, leadership and medication management.

The surveyors assessed Cleveland Clinic Abu Dhabi on more than 1,000 combined standards and measurable elements and found that the hospital was compliant with standards, scoring particularly highly in the areas of International Patient Safety Goals, Access to Care & Continuity of Care, Patient & Family Rights, Patient & Family Education, and Quality and Patient Safety.
